What is a major disadvantage of a market economy?

Government interventions include price-fixing, licensing, quotas, and industrial subsidies. Benefits of a market economy include increased efficiency, production, and innovation. Disadvantages include monopolies, no government intervention, poor working conditions, and unemployment.

What are 5 disadvantages of a market economy?

Disadvantages of a market economy include inequality, negative externalities, limited government intervention, uncertainty and instability, and lack of public goods.

What are the failures of the market economy?

Market failure is the economic situation defined by an inefficient distribution of goods and services in the free market. In market failure, the individual incentives for rational behavior do not lead to rational outcomes for the group.

What is one disadvantage of a command economy?

Command economy advantages include low levels of inequality and unemployment and the common objective of replacing profit as the primary incentive of production. Command economy disadvantages include lack of competition, which can lead to a lack of innovation and lack of efficiency.

What is market economy simple?

A market economy is an economic system in which individuals, rather than the state, own most of the resources. This includes land, labor, and capital. In a market economy, individuals control the use and price of these resources through voluntary decisions made in the marketplace.

What are four disadvantages of a command economy?

The disadvantages of a command economy are:
  • There is less economic freedom.
  • Businesses do not have the freedom to make decisions about what to produce and how much to produce.
  • The government can distort pricing signals, which can lead to inefficiencies in the economy.

Is alcohol a demerit good?

A demerit good is a good or service whose consumption is considered harmful to the consumer themselves. They include products tobacco, alcohol, and gambling products, which can lead to addiction and health problems. In addition, demerit goods can also cause pollution and other environmental damage.

What are the 8 causes of market failure?

Some of the major causes of market failure are:
  • Incomplete markets,
  • Indivisibilities,
  • Common Property Resources,
  • Imperfect Markets,
  • Asymmetric Information,
  • Externalities,
  • Public Goods and.
  • Public Bads.
